Concrete raising services involve elevating sunken or uneven concrete slabs to restore their proper level and appearance. This process typically uses specialized materials, such as polyurethane foam, to lift and stabilize the affected areas without the need for complete removal or replacement. The procedure is designed to be minimally invasive, allowing for a quicker turnaround compared to traditional concrete replacement methods. By restoring the original height of the concrete, service providers help improve the structural integrity and visual appeal of the property’s surfaces.

These services are primarily sought to address problems caused by soil movement, erosion, or settling that lead to uneven or cracked concrete slabs. Common issues include trip hazards in walkways, uneven driveways, cracked patios, and sinking garage floors. Left unaddressed, these problems can worsen over time, potentially causing further damage or safety concerns. Concrete raising offers a practical solution to level out these surfaces, preventing potential accidents and reducing the need for costly repairs or replacements in the future.

Concrete Leveling services involve raising sunken slabs to restore proper elevation and improve safety. Local contractors provide solutions to stabilize uneven concrete surfaces in residential and commercial properties.

Mudjacking is a technique used to lift and level concrete by injecting a slurry beneath the slab. Service providers in the area offer this method to address uneven driveways, sidewalks, and patios.

Polyurethane Foam Raising offers a quick and minimally invasive way to lift settled concrete using expanding foam. Local specialists can assist with restoring the surface integrity of various concrete installations.

Slab Jacking involves lifting and stabilizing concrete slabs that have settled due to soil movement. Contractors experienced in this process serve neighborhoods like Sterling Heights and nearby communities.

What is concrete raising? Concrete raising is a process that lifts and restores sunken or uneven concrete slabs, improving their appearance and functionality.

How do professionals raise concrete? Local service providers typically use foam or mud jacking techniques to lift and level the concrete surface.

Is concrete raising a permanent solution? When performed properly, concrete raising can provide a long-lasting fix for uneven slabs, though underlying issues should be addressed.

What are common signs that concrete needs raising? Visible cracks, uneven surfaces, and areas that have settled or shifted are indicators that concrete raising may be needed.

Can concrete raising be done on any type of slab? Most residential concrete slabs, such as driveways, sidewalks, and patios, can be raised, but a professional assessment is recommended for specific cases.
